Introduction of Driver’s License Categories

Before diving into costs, it’s vital to comprehend the types of driver’s licenses offered in Belgium. The licenses are categorized according to the cars they permit you to drive. The main categories are:

License Category Description Typical Age Requirement
B Passenger automobiles (approximately 3.5 loads) 18 years
C Trucks (over 3.5 loads) 21 years
D Buses 24 years
AM Mopeds and scooters (up to 50cc) 16 years

Cost Breakdown of Obtaining a Belgian Driver’s License

The overall cost of obtaining a chauffeur’s license in Belgium consists of a number of components, including application fees, theory and Belgisch rijbewijs Verkrijgen practical test fees, driving lessons, and medical check-ups. Here’s a thorough breakdown:

1. Application Fees

To obtain a motorist’s license, candidates must pay an application cost. The fees differ based on the category of the license:

License Category Application Fee
B EUR35
C EUR50
D EUR50
AM EUR25

2. Theory Test Fees

Before taking the useful driving test, candidates should pass a theory exam to demonstrate their understanding of road rules:

Test Type Charge
Theory Test EUR15

3. Practical Test Fees

After successfully passing the theory test, candidates can schedule their useful test. The cost is as follows:

Test Type Charge
Dry Run (B) EUR50
Dry Run (C/D) EUR75

4. Driving Lessons

Many candidates go with professional driving lessons, which can significantly vary in price depending upon the driving school and the number of lessons needed. Here’s an approximate variety:

Driving Lesson Type Cost per Hour
Private Lesson EUR45 – EUR70
Package Deals EUR400 – EUR800

5. Medical Check-Up

For specific license categories (especially C and D), a medical exam is required to ensure the prospect is fit to drive:

Medical Examination Cost
General Examination EUR50 – EUR100

6. Other Costs

Additional costs may consist of:

  • Theory Books/Study Materials: EUR20 – EUR50
  • Driving School Registration Fees: EUR50 – EUR100
  • License Issuance Fee: EUR25

Overall Estimated Costs

Taking into consideration all the components pointed out above, here’s a rough estimate of the total expenses associated with getting a Category B motorist’s license:

Cost Component Approximated Cost (EUR)
Application Fee EUR35
Theory Test Fee EUR15
Dry Run Fee EUR50
Driving Lessons (10 hours) EUR450 – EUR700
Medical Check-Up EUR50 – EUR100
License Issuance Fee EUR25
Total Estimated Cost EUR625 – EUR1,000

(This table provides a rough price quote; real expenses might differ.)

Factors Influencing Costs

The general cost of a chauffeur’s license in Belgium can fluctuate based upon various aspects:

  1. Driving School Choice: Different schools have different fee structures, including package that may provide savings.
  2. Personal Learning Pace: Some prospects might require more driving lessons than others.
  3. License Category: Higher categories (such as C and D) normally sustain greater expenses due to additional tests and medical checks.

Frequently Asked Questions about Belgian Driver’s License Costs

Q1: How long does it require to get a motorist’s license in Belgium?

A1: The duration can vary extensively, based on the candidate’s preparation and the school’s accessibility. Generally, it takes numerous weeks to a few months to finish the essential lessons and tests.

Q2: Is it necessary to take driving lessons?

A2: While it is elective, taking professional driving lessons is extremely recommended, particularly for unskilled drivers.

Q3: Can I take the theory test in English?

A3: Yes, the theory test is available in numerous languages, consisting of English, French, and Dutch.

Q4: Are there any scholarships or monetary assistance programs available?

A4: While scholarships specifically for driving lessons are uncommon, some local efforts might offer monetary aid to unemployed individuals.

Q5: Do I require to restore my driver’s license, and if so, how much does it cost?

A5: Driver’s licenses in Belgium require to be renewed every 10 years. The renewal charge is usually around EUR25.
